#1b4521 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b4521 is composed of 10.6% red, 27.1%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.2%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 128.6 degrees, a saturation of 43.8% and a lightness of 18.8%. #1b4521 color hex could be obtained by blending #368a42 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#1b4521 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b4521 has RGB values of R:27, G:69, B:33 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 1787169.
